OneRedArmy
29/10/2008, 10:30 AM
Hes good under the big high long ball but he lacks pace :)Shows the ridiculous nature of this thread, as is pointed out every year.

As pointed out above, Delaney could well be our Player of the Season.

None of us see enough games to make anything near an informed judgement, so people either
1) pick too many of their own teams players
2) base it on the one or two games they see of opposition players
3) make assumptions based on previous seasons
